Analysis

In 2025, bank liquid reserves to bank assets ratio in Mongolia stood at 56.8%.

That represents a change of up 5.0% on the previous year and up 141.3% over ten years.

Over the whole period, bank liquid reserves to bank assets ratio in Mongolia peaked at 57.4% in 2020 and was at its lowest, 13.9%, in 2007.

Mongolia ranks 12th of 151 countries on this measure, in the top 10%.

The long-run direction has been consistently rising across the 25 years of available data.

Ratio of bank liquid reserves to bank assets is the ratio of domestic currency holdings and deposits with the monetary authorities to claims on other governments, nonfinancial public enterprises, the private sector, and other banking institutions. This indicator is expressed as a percentage (a÷b)*100.
